We’re looking for a talented, highly motivated, and energetic Document Publisher to join our team of creatives in North America (currently in a remote capacity). You’ll be part of a thriving, collaborative, inclusive team, delivering professional documents to our internal and external clients. You’ll engage with publishing colleagues to create and refine project documentation into clean, clear, attractive publications, following company standards and client requirements. A Document Publisher’s diverse range of skills includes creating and using custom templates, applying Jacobs branded styles as appropriate, document formatting, proofreading text for spelling or grammatical errors, and simple graphic development and page layout. A Document Publisher often will work on a document from conception to production and delivery.

Here’s What You’ll Need:
  • Expertise formatting in Microsoft Word (MS), Excel, and PowerPoint according to established company brand or project-specific styles and template requirements
  • MS Word: Expert knowledge creating and applying Word templates, manipulating styles, using mail merge, creating and using macros, section breaks, page layout, cross-references, tracked changes, and troubleshooting document formatting issues
  • MS Excel: Basic knowledge of formatting a spreadsheet, formulas, and manipulating graphs and charts
  • MS PowerPoint: Basic knowledge of how to apply formatting to an established template
  • Expertise in Adobe publishing programs
    • Acrobat: Expert knowledge of creating complex PDFs of reports that include multiple figures, tables, and appendixes for client review
    • InDesign, Illustrator, and Photoshop: Basic knowledge is a plus but not required
  • Understanding of a wide variety of shared workspace platforms (SharePoint, ProjectWise, etc.), document-related software techniques, visual mediums, and delivery options
  • Experience working as part of a team and collaborating with editorial, graphic design, document publishing, production, and technical staff
  • Demonstrated time management skills, to include completing work on time, communicating your current workload and upcoming availability, scheduling your participation on long-term projects, and efficiently offloading work to your colleagues if you’re overbooked
  • A commitment to providing the best quality work you can in the time provided for the work, to include engaging in quality reviews and implementing feedback
  • Flexibility to work occasional evenings and weekends when our success depends on you

Ideally, you’ll also have:

  • Bachelor's degree; relevant job experience may be accepted in lieu of degree
  • Understanding of grammatical rules, punctuation, and references and citations.
  • Experience with best practices for document accessibility (Section 508, AODA, WCAG, PDF/UA)
  • Experience in an engineering consulting environment
